All Miami-Dade County residents can visit the Miami-Dade County Home Chemical Collection Centers any time during normal operating hours (9 a.m. to 5 p.m., Wednesday – Sunday). No appointment is needed. No commercial disposal is permitted.

The Town of Surfside presented its highest scholarship award during Tuesday’s Town Commission meeting on Sept. 9, 2025.
Joaquin Alino, now a student at the University of Florida, was awarded the $1,000 scholarship in recognition of his academic achievement and community involvement. His mother attended the meeting to accept the award on his behalf.
Town Manager Mark Blumstein congratulated Alino, noting the significance of supporting Surfside’s youth as they pursue higher education.
“Joaquin represents the best of Surfside’s future,” Blumstein said. “We are proud to support his journey and look forward to seeing the impact he will make in the years ahead.”
The scholarship is the Town’s most prestigious student recognition and is awarded annually to a graduating senior who has demonstrated academic excellence and commitment to the community.
